The Amsterdam International Community School South East has acquired recently bins of the Luna model by Cervic Environment with capacity for 3 different residues to simplify recycling in their facilities.

Luna bin is a multiwaste space-saving bin, which perfectly fits in offices, classrooms, hotel rooms,… The independent and removable plastic buckets make easy both emptying it and cleaning it.

The Amsterdam International Community School South East, located in Amsterdam (The Netherlands), admits students from 4 to 19 years old from 23 different. Subjects are taught in English and this school is part of the Esprit Scholengroep, a group of international schools for Primary and Secondary levels in Amsterdam.
